Labour Day BBQ feast

Make the most of the final long weekend of summer with the barbecue to end all barbecues. This menu covers all the classics, so get ready to load up your plate.

Mains
Inside-out cheddar burger Amp up the burgers by adding the cheese to the middle. Then, take it one step further with our secret sauce.

Haute hot dogs A big barbecue always calls for a little extra variety — and here guests can take care of the hard part: choosing the toppings.

Saucy barbecued chicken Pass around the napkins, and get a little messy.

Sides
Baby-red potato salad recipe Red potatoes not only add a vibrant pop of colour to this classic side dish, they also hold their shape better than other potato varieties, so any leftovers will be equally fantastic.

Mediterranean summer pasta salad Tossed with romano beans, olives and parsley, this colourful pasta is an impressive (and easy), make-ahead dish.

Dessert
Peach crisp Top this warm, crumbly crisp with whipped cream, and enjoy.

Very berry galette For the pie lovers. Get your hands on the last of summer's best berries, and whip together easy pastry for a gorgeous, rustic pie.
